The Dansavanh Casino is based in Ban Muang Wa-Tha, Vientiane State. This Laos gambling den creates a good many jobs for the locals, who occasionally do not continually have a chance to earn a decent income. The Dansavanh Casino is essentially dependent upon tourists in order to make ends meet. Locals generally only work at the casinos and do not bet their money on gaming. Because nearby countries such as Thailand are filled with blaring, flamboyant gambling dens, Dansavanh Casino concentrates more on tourists from China, which borders Laos on the Northeastern edge.
The Chinese government has consistently been very much opposed to gaming, primarily inside its own borders. This is why nations like Laos can open gambling halls and be immediately successful–bettors from other states. Because betting is so censored in China, the sightseers travel to casinos in excitement to allay their curiosity, and they more often than not spend very big. Laos gambling halls have for a long time benefited from this type of gambling.
